
Woody Allen was once a highly sought-after film director, attracting top actors eager to collaborate with him. However, accusations made by his daughter Dylan, alleging abuse from a young age, dramatically changed his career. Allen strongly denies these claims. Following the allegations, several prominent actors, including Michael Caine, Colin Firth, and Greta Gerwig, have refused to work with him or have expressed remorse for past collaborations. This backlash and avoidance of his work continue to this day.
In a recent interview with the Wall Street Journal, he explained that when an actor refuses to work with someone else, they often believe they’re acting ethically and making a positive statement. However, he believes this is usually a misjudgment and they’ll likely realize their mistake eventually.
He expressed his surprise that people don’t seem to use common sense when they learn about the situation. He noted that he’s consistently amazed by how quickly people accept things without questioning them. He would expect someone reading the details to recognize that something doesn’t seem right.
Mia Farrow has stated she was able to distinguish between her professional work with Woody Allen and the difficulties they faced in their personal relationship.
